Walk to the highest point of the Cliffs of Moher, standing at two hundred and fourteen meters above sea level, where breathtaking views stretch across the Dingle Peninsula and Loop Head to the south, the Aran Islands to the west, and the Twelve Pins and mountains of Connemara to the north on a clear day. From O’Brien’s Tower, take in the stunning vistas of lush green grass, rugged rocky cliffs, and the ever-changing shades of the sea and sky while listening to the powerful waves of the mighty Atlantic Ocean crashing below.
The walk takes approximately three hours, beginning in the charming village of Doolin and following a picturesque gravel path that winds its way along the breathtaking coastline to the Cliffs of Moher Visitor Centre. Along the way, walkers can enjoy stunning views of the Atlantic Ocean, rolling green fields, and dramatic cliff edges, making for a truly memorable experience. The trail itself is an easy and enjoyable hike, suitable for those with a basic level of fitness, though a good head for heights is recommended as portions of the path run close to the cliff’s edge. Covering a total distance of eight kilometers, the journey offers plenty of opportunities to soak in the natural beauty of the region while embracing the fresh sea air and the soothing sounds of waves crashing against the cliffs below. To ensure a seamless experience, a taxi ride back to Doolin village from the Cliffs of Moher Visitor Centre is included in the ticket price, allowing visitors to relax and reflect on their incredible walk while enjoying a hassle-free return journey.
Please bring suitable walking boots, warm, layered, wind and rainproof gear as weather can be changeable.
